Amiga 1000 composite video output (colour?)
Hi All,
I recently got a few A1000's, just going over them and some have colour on the single RCA composite output whilst others are only B/W. I didn't think any of the early Amiga's had colour output unless you had an A520 plugged in and used its output. So I guess my questions are, did the A1000 have colour output on the RCA video output and I just have a few faulty ones (B/W)? Or might have someone modified them for colour output on the RCA connector? TIA |

The A1000 uses a colour TV encoder chip, whereas the A500 have a Commodore video hybrid board that only provides monochrome output. Not sure if there are different versions of the A1000 in that regard though.

Some early PAL models (I guess original models with daughterboard only) can have PAL Agnus but NTSC configured video encoder (MC1377 pin 20 grounded = NTSC mode + NTSC external components) and NTSC main clock crystal. (PAL=28.37516MHz, NTSC=28.63636MHz, inside the metal box)

A little more on this, I pulled the lid off to start looking around the video output circuits.
The datasheet for the MC1377P chip says ground pin 20 for NTSC, open for PAL. Well on my PCB there is no jumper, Pin 20 just goes direct to GND, there is no provision for a jumper on the PCB. Looking at the PCB images on Amiga Hardware Database it looks like this one is an NTSC PCB, even though on the back it says "PAL' so dunno what the go is now. |
